Barcelona Hills Elementary School, located in Mission Viejo, is a preschool-through-fifth-grade campus with over 500 students. Our unique student-centered learning environment sets it apart from other schools around the nation.

In 1997, Barcelona Hills was recognized by the United States Department of Education as a National Blue Ribbon School. This prestigious award was bestowed on only 262 schools nationwide and was based on Barcelona Hills’ ability to meet rigorous standards in the following areas: high academic standards and achievement, teaching techniques, parent and community support, leadership, learning environment and organizational vitality. A group of school representatives traveled to Washington D.C. in the fall of 1998 to receive this award, the highest honor which can be given to a school. In 1993, the school was named a California Distinguished School as well. Only four percent of all elementary schools in California are given this recognition.

At Barcelona Hills, innovative strategies effectively address the use of time, space and staffing. Teachers at each grade level work and plan teaching techniques together. Teachers in the grades four and five “specialize” in a particular content area and teach this subject to the entire grade level. This strategy capitalizes on the strengths and talents of each teacher. On Wednesday ACE Days, teachers work in teams to study student data that will lead to more effective instruction.

Technology is used in every area of the curriculum at Barcelona Hills. Our school is completely networked, allowing upper-grade students to use the Internet as a tool for learning. Computers are readily accessible in all classrooms as well as a primary computer lab. Children in grades K-3 are involved in technology-based language arts and mathematics programs. Upper-grade students use computers 2-3 times weekly to enhance writing skills using the Write Away! Program.

Barcelona Hills students, staff and parents take an active role in our community. Our school has great participation at annual events such as the Mission Viejo Red Ribbon Walk against Drugs. The school has been awarded the city’s Walk Against Drugs banner for several years as a result of this excellent group attendance.
